Steven L. Matthews is a scholar working on Inorganic Chemistry,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Organic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Steven L. Matthews has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 394 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Inorganic Chemistry, 5 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 5 papers in Organic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Steven L. Matthews’s work include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(5 papers), Molecular Spectroscopy and Structure (4 papers) and Organometallic Complex Synthesis and Catalysis (4 papers). Steven L. Matthews is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(5 papers), Molecular Spectroscopy and Structure (4 papers) and Organometallic Complex Synthesis and Catalysis (4 papers). Steven L. Matthews coll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Russia. Steven L. Matthews's co-authors include D. Michael Heinekey, Vincent Pons, Frank Marken, Barry A. Coles, Richard G. Compton, Simon B. Duckett, Khuong Q. Vuong, Michael W. George, A. C. Legon and Nicholas R. Walker and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Chemical Communications.
